Position Overview

The Horticulture Intern will report on a day-to-day basis to the Director of Horticulture or their designee.  The intern will gain valuable hands-on experience in ecological horticultural practices, including indoor and outdoor display garden maintenance, groundskeeping, record-keeping, and basic plant care.  In addition, the intern will be given time and resources to develop a project presentation that will complement their related personnel interest.  The final presentation will be given to NEBG staff.  Field trips to other horticultural sites as well as pertinent networking opportunities will be included during the course of the internship.

Schedule

The Horticulture Internship position is full-time temporary and non-exempt. The standard work schedule for this position is approximately 40 paid hours per week, either Tuesday through Saturday or Sunday through Thursday 7:00am to 3:30am with an unpaid 30-minute lunch.; however, the schedule may be flexible to suit the needs of the organization, may involve weekend hours, and may involve evening hours. Work is performed both indoors and outdoors, and the Horticulture Intern may be asked to assist with event administration in both indoor and outdoor roles.

Physical Demands / Working Conditions

  • Must be able to lift 50 pounds repeatedly.
  • Must be able to work indoors in conservatory conditions and outdoors in all seasonal extremes.
  • Must be able to bend, squat, kneel, stand, and walk for extended periods of time and to navigate uneven grounds and stairs evenly.
  • Poison ivy, ticks, mosquitoes, bees, and other stinging insects will be encountered on the property. Training and personal protective equipment will be provided.
  • Must be able to comfortably and safely work at heights on ladders with training.
  • Must be able to work with appropriate tools and machinery.
  • Must be able to work with standard communications equipment and office technology and software.

Qualifications:

Preference will be given to those candidates who have some or all the following qualifications:

  • One or more years of college-level course work in horticulture, propagation, botany, landscape design, plant conservation, or other plant-related field, or equivalent experience.
  • Previous work experience in a nursery, greenhouse, or arboretum/botanic garden or in park maintenance.
  • Career plans in the fields of horticulture, landscape architecture, or another plant-related field.
  • Responsible and self-motivated.
  • Preference for summer internships is given to those who can begin in May and commit to three full months.
